Senator Katie Britt Advocates for the GUARD Act to Combat Financial Fraud Against Seniors

The Growing Crisis of Financial Fraud

  • 🚨 Americans are facing crisis levels of financial fraud, with seniors being particularly vulnerable.
  • πŸ’° In 2024 alone, seniors lost over $4.8 billion to scammers, with the average victim losing more than $83,000.
  • πŸ“ˆ Scammers are increasingly sophisticated, leveraging new technologies like the blockchain to bypass traditional safeguards.
  • ⚠️ This fraud can be devastating for seniors and their families, especially those on fixed incomes.

Limitations of Current Law Enforcement

  • πŸ› οΈ State and local law enforcement are working diligently but often lack the specialization, training, and tools needed to investigate complex financial crimes.
  • βš–οΈ Scammers exploit these gaps, making it difficult to hold them accountable.

The GUARD Act: A Solution for Enhanced Investigations

  • πŸ’‘ The GUARD Act aims to empower state, local, and tribal law enforcement to combat financial fraud more effectively.
  • πŸš€ The bill would allow these agencies to use existing grant programs to hire agents, train staff, and increase resources for investigating financial fraud, including on the blockchain.
  • 🀝 It also permits federal law enforcement agencies to share their expertise with state and local partners on blockchain investigations.
  • βœ… This legislation will provide crucial new tools to protect Americans, particularly seniors, and bring perpetrators to justice.

Bipartisan Support for the GUARD Act

  • 🀝 Senator Britt thanked Senator Gillibrand for her leadership and partnership on this critical legislation.
  • πŸ‘ The bill has strong bipartisan co-sponsorship, including from committee members like Senators Moody, Grassley, Klobuchar, Coons, Rick Scott, Langford, and Warnock.
